Child directed speech: the language that adults use for children so that they can understand the sentences are shorter and easier, speech is slower. Phonology: slower, clear pronunciation, more pauses, higher pitch, exaggerated intonation. Lexis: simpler, restricted vocabulary, diminutive forms e. g. doggie, concrete lexis referring to objects in immediate surrounding. Grammar: simpler constructions, frequent use of imperatives, lots of repetition, frequent questions, use of personal names instead of pronouns.
